This is a minor thing. It’s a convention, not a rule (obviously)—but it’s also a best practice. Many text editors look for this kind of comment as the first line—or second line, if there is a shebang (the `#!/usr/bin/env python`, or whatever else)—and make use of this to determine the file’s encoding.
